Ticket #: open
Site: Durnley Point, Block C
Summary: Landlord audit Thursday, 09:00–15:00. Contractors on site must keep corridors clear and make riser cupboards accessible. Sign in at the loading dock, not the lobby. The dock door will be locked during the audit; enter using the keypad code below.

door code, yagap-bahof: bdg-O-05

## Artifact Signing — Clock Skew

Build agents in the Dunmere pool drifted up to 40s, producing signatures with future timestamps that failed verification. NTP sync is now enforced pre-sign; builds abort if skew exceeds 5s. Release manager: reject any artifact timestamped ahead of the coordinator. Re-verification uses the active signing key below.

deploy key for kajof-fajop: bky6_gDHw9Q

Subject: Your first week on-call — Pipewren broker upgrade

Hi Tomas,

Welcome aboard. We're mid-upgrade on the Pipewren message broker, moving the Ashgrove cluster from the 4.x line to 5.x. Brokers are upgraded one at a time with a 24-hour soak between nodes. If a page fires during your shift, do not roll back on your own — rollback requires coordinated partition reassignment and has burned us before. Upgrade status, node order, and the rollback procedure are all tracked on the internal page here.

operations page: https://kibana.sivrelcloud.corp/browse/spaces/spaces/issue/16dd39fa3e3f990c

Onboarding note for reception staff at Quillmere House: the bike cage sits behind the east courtyard, and the parking gates are on Ferrow Lane. New starters often ask for access on day one before their permanent badge is ready. Verify their name against the starters list from People Operations, then issue the temporary gate code printed below.

door code, fajef-tahog: bdg-Q-71